Mechanisms for Time Travel and Wormhole Transporters

Time travel, a concept that has intrigued humanity for centuries, continues to capture the imagination of scientists and enthusiasts alike. While still largely theoretical, several mechanisms have been proposed that could potentially allow for traversing the fabric of time.
1. Wormholes

One of the most popular concepts for time travel involves the use of wormholes. Wormholes are hypothetical tunnels in spacetime that connect two separate points in the universe. By manipulating the geometry of a wormhole, it might be possible to create a shortcut through spacetime, enabling travel between different points in time as well as space.
2. Alcubierre Drive

The Alcubierre Drive is a speculative concept that involves the distortion of spacetime to facilitate faster-than-light travel. While originally proposed for interstellar travel, some theorists have suggested that the Alcubierre Drive could potentially be adapted for time travel by manipulating the spacetime curvature in a specific manner.
3. Tipler Cylinder

The Tipler Cylinder is a hypothetical construct proposed by physicist Frank J. Tipler. It involves the idea of a massive spinning cylinder that could theoretically warp spacetime in a way that allows for closed timelike curves. While the practicality of constructing such a device remains a significant challenge, it represents an intriguing concept for time travel.
